The port city of Fremantle is a jewel in Western Australia's crown, largely because of its colonial architectural heritage and hippy vibe.

Freo (as the locals call it) is a city of largely friendly, interesting, and sometimes eccentric residents supportive of busking, street art, and alfresco dining.

Like all great port cities, Freo is cosmopolitan, with mariners from all parts of the world strolling the streets—including thousands of U.S.

Navy personnel on rest and recreation throughout the year.

It's also a good jumping-off point for a day trip to Rottnest Island, where lovely beaches, rocky coves, and unique wallaby-like inhabitants called quokkas set the scene.Modern Fremantle is a far cry from the barren, sandy plain that greeted the first wave of English settlers back in 1829 at the newly constituted Swan River Colony.

Most were city dwellers, and after five months at sea in sailing ships they landed on salt-marsh flats that sorely tested their fortitude.

Living in tents with packing cases for chairs, they found no edible crops, and the nearest freshwater was a distant 51 km (32 miles)—and a tortuous trip up the waters of the Swan.

As a result they soon moved the settlement upriver to the vicinity of present-day Perth.Fremantle remained the principal port, and many attractive limestone buildings were built to service the port traders.

Australia's 1987 defense of the America's Cup—held in waters off Fremantle—triggered a major restoration of the colonial streetscapes.

In the leafy suburbs nearly every other house is a restored 19th-century gem.

Proclaimed a city on July 1, 1998, Albany with a population of 28,000 is rapidly expanding.

It is the commercial center of Western Australia's southern region and the oldest settlement in the state, established in 1826.

Boasting an excellent harbor on King George Sound led to Albany becoming a thriving whaling port.

Later, when steam ships started traveling between England and Australia, Albany was an important coaling station and served as a penal and a military outpost.

The coastline offers some of Australia's most rugged and spectacular scenery.

At certain times of the year, whales can be spotted off the coast.

Among the city's attractions are some fine old colonial buildings that reflect Albany's Victorian heritage.

Various lookout points offer stunning vistas.
